Understanding OHS Compliance
OHS compliance involves adhering to the regulations and standards set by local, state, and federal bodies to ensure a safe and healthy working environment. It requires a thorough understanding of these regulations and the ability to implement them effectively.
Training Methods for OHS Compliance
Training methods for OHS compliance can vary depending on the nature of the work and the learning preferences of the employees. They can include classroom training, online learning, on-the-job training, and simulation training.
Techniques for Ensuring Compliance
Techniques for ensuring compliance can include regular audits and inspections, clear communication of safety policies and procedures, and fostering a culture of safety in the workplace.
